Robot Chicken Presents: Star Trek II: The Wrath Of Khan, The Opera

No eels in my ears!

No eels in my ears!

Wow, Robot Chicken has truly outdone itself. This adorable claymation rendition of an Italian stage translation of Star Trek II: Wrath Of Khan is fantastic stupendous. Especially the “lowering of the mind control eels”  song.

This entry was posted in Entertainment and tagged , .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*